About Caleb B. Morris

Caleb B. Morris is a scholar working on Spectroscopy, Molecular Biology, Analytical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ering and Infectious Diseases, having authored 5 papers that have together received 645 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(5 papers), Mass Spectrometry Techniques and Applications (5 papers),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(3 papers), Advanced Chemical Sensor Technologies (1 paper) and Analytical chemistry methods development (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Spectroscopy (541 citations), Analytical Chemistry (91 citations), Molecular Biology (345 citations), Computational Mechanics (43 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(72 citations). Caleb B. Morris has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Jody C. May, John A. McLean, Katrina L. Leaptrot, E. J. Darland, John C. Fjeldsted, William H. Barry, G. Overney, Christian D. Klein, Alex Mordehai and Ruwan T. Kurulugama. Their work appears in journals such as Analytical Chemistry, Journal of the American Society for Mass Spectrometry and Methods in molecular biology.
